package ftbsc.lll;

import org.objectweb.asm.tree.ClassNode;
import org.objectweb.asm.tree.MethodNode;

/**
 * Patch classes should implement this interface and be declared as services in
 * the META-INF/services folder (or through modules in Java 9+, but only Java 8
 * is officially supported).
 */

public interface IInjector {

   /**
    * @return name of injector, for logging
    */
   String name();

   /**
    * @return reason for this patch, for logging
    */
   default String reason() { return "No reason specified"; }

   /**
    * This is used to identify which classes should be altered, and on which class
    * should this injector operate.
    * Class name should be dot-separated, for example "net.minecraft.client.Minecraft".
    * @return class to transform
    */
   String targetClass();

   /**
    * This is used to identify the method to transform within the class.
    * It should return the name of target.
    * @return method to transform
    */
   String methodName();

   /**
    * This should return the target method's descriptor.
    * Methods in Java may have the same name but different parameters: a descriptor
    * compiles that information, as well as the return type, in as little space as
    * possible.
    * Examples:
    * <ul>
    *  <li>(IF)V - returns void, takes in int and float</li>
    *  <li>(Ljava/lang/Object;)I - returns int, takes in a java.lang.Object</li>
    *  <li>(ILjava/lang/String;)[I - returns int[], takes in an int and a String</li>
    * </ul>
    * See ASM's <a href="https://asm.ow2.io/asm4-guide.pdf">documentation</a> for a more detailed explanation.
    * @return descriptor of method to target.
    */
   String methodDesc();

   /**
    * This method is to be called by the launcher after identifying the right class and
    * method to patch. The overriding method should contain the logic for actually
    * pathing.
    * @param clazz  the {@link ClassNode} currently being patched
    * @param method the {@link MethodNode} of method currently being patched
    */
   void inject(ClassNode clazz, MethodNode method);
}
